Brilliant Benchmark Performance of the 1st Batch at RGUKT: The fruits of the academic excellence created under the leadership of Prof Raja kumar resulted out in to excellent performance by the university students right from the first batch itself (despite starting with the annual intake of 6000), in many ways. Here are a few examples. Excellent performance in GATE -2014 with no extra coaching: The 1st batch students appeared in GATE-2014, in their final year BTech with no scope for extra or outside coaching. Out of the 950 respondents in a survey conducted, more than 650 students claimed that they got qualified. Some students secured All India Ranks 8, 20, 25, 30,...., , a remarkable performance by any standards. Many students joined the PG programmes in IIT’s and public sector industries after completing their BTech based on the GATE performance. Perhaps, no other institute including the NIT’s / university in the country every got this type of performance with its first batch. Un-heard of performance in Service Commission Recruitments: The students of the first two batches showed outstanding performance which is unheard of the in the country in public service commission recruitments. To cite an example, 272 students from two classes of Civil Engg (2014 and 2015) of the Basara campus alone reported that they got selected for Asst Executive / Asst Engineer positions in the TNPSC recruitments during 2016-17. Needless to mention that such an excellence is not heard from any university or institute in the country. This one example is good enough to illustrate the truly exceptional human resources even two classes of a campus of RGUKT could provide the state with. Brilliant Performance in UGC NET (JRF) Despite that the number of candidates appeared is extremely small since it is not very appropriate for, the performance in UGC NET (JRF) was extremely good and one student got All India 2nd rank. Highest Number of Awards in the NASA Competition: As many as, 54 students won prizes (highest by any institution in the world) and laurels in the design contests conducted by NASA Ames Research Center, USA. 34 of the students attended the NASA conferences held at San Diego, USA and received their prizes. Excellent Academic Performance: The university has graduated over 5,400 of its first batch of students in June 2014 with 33% of them securing distinction and another 65% of them getting first class. An amazing 1300 students earned a Minor in the first batch and perhaps it is the highest ever in the country including all the IIT’s, in any year, so far. Despite that it was the first batch and that the university didn’t have history yet, as many as 1000 students got placed through the campus placement cells. There were many more laurels won including, TWITMINER contest of the CSA, IISc, Bangalore in Natural Language Processing (NLP) and the Ramanujam prize.
